It impact any fresh install of 18.04, trying to run dehydrated as well:
Same error as Debian Bug report logs - #934039
On Ubuntu 18.04 dehydrated is stuck in version 0.6.1-2
Let's encrypt production API was changed in August 2019 (before the issue was only on the Staging Environment API).
